About Geranyl Crotonate
Geranyl Crotonate is an ester in which parts derived from an acid and an alcohol are joined together.[1] The rate at which its scent disperses and the persistence of the dry-down may vary depending on its molecular size and volatility, as well as the combination of fragrances used with it. In cosmetics, it is used to add fragrance to a product or adjust the characteristic odor of raw materials.[1]
